How Much Does a Master’s in Interactive Multimedia from National University Cost?

$15,480 Average Tuition and Fees

National University Graduate Tuition and Fees

In 2019-2020, the average part-time graduate tuition at National University was $430 per credit hour for both in-state and out-of-state students. The following table shows the average full-time tuition and fees for graduate student.

In StateOut of State
Tuition$15,480$15,480

National University Master’s Student Diversity for Interactive Multimedia

7 Master's Degrees Awarded
85.7% Women
57.1% Racial-Ethnic Minorities*
There were 7 master’s degrees in interactive multimedia awarded during the 2019-2020 academic year. Information about those students is shown below.

Male-to-Female Ratio

About 85.7% of the students who received their MA in interactive multimedia in 2019-2020 were women. This is higher than the nationwide number of 69.1%.

Racial-Ethnic Diversity

Racial-ethnic minority graduates* made up 57.1% of the interactive multimedia master’s degrees at National University in 2019-2020. This is higher than the nationwide number of 29%.

*The racial-ethnic minorities count is calculated by taking the total number of students and subtracting white students, international students, and students whose race/ethnicity was unknown. This number is then divided by the total number of students at the school to obtain the racial-ethnic minorities percentage.
